Full Stack/Site Reliability Engineer

company banner
OSI Engineering, Inc.
Docker, TypeScript, Postgresql, RabbitMQ, Pulsar, Redis, Prometheus, Grafana, AWS
Full Time
Depends on Experience

Job Description

Senior Site Reliability Engineer  for Sports Broadcasting Company (Remote in US)

Description

Our client is building the next way of seeing sports. We deliver unique and innovative solutions through unparalleled capabilities in machine understanding of sports.

  • We are the official tracking and analytics provider of the English Premier League, NBA, and MLS and have numerous clients across multiple sports at the team, league, and media level.
  • We developed a real-time video augmentation pipeline that powers the innovative content featured in products like the award-winning Clippers CourtVision, and has also been used by ESPN, Turner Sports, BT Sport, FOX, and International NBA League Pass.
  • We produce the most accurate tracking data with the fastest high-quality output by leveraging the most automated and extensible solution in the market.

We are looking for a Senior Full Stack Software Engineer to join our Product Engineering group to help build and improve our AI-based sports analytics products. This group is primarily responsible for our web and mobile applications that are used by teams, leagues, coaches, and fans. They ensure our customers have a seamless user experience within our products for the thousands of sporting events we run each year.

We are seeking a Senior Site Reliability Engineer to be a member of the Infrastructure Engineering group. Scale at Second Spectrum is driven by live events and it is common for resource usage to burst 100x. The infrastructure group builds the platform on which all Second Spectrum products are deployed, scaled, and monitored. We have been using now industry standard technologies, like Kubernetes and Terraform, for almost half a decade.

Responsibilities:

  • First and foremost, write software to build and maintain the deployment architecture that powers Second Spectrum’s products.
  • Identify technologies and processes to take the deployment architecture to the next level in reliability, cost-effectiveness, and ease of use.
  • Empower engineers to build, test, deploy, and monitor services by themselves.
  • Mentor and collaborate with engineers on other teams to promote healthy deployment practices.
  • Participate in an on-call rotation that emphasizes eliminating repeating escalations.
     

Our Stack

  • Docker and container scheduling (Kubernetes)
  • Typescript, Rust, Terraform
  • Postgresql, RabbitMQ, Pulsar, Redis
  • Prometheus, Grafana, Loki, Elasticsearch
  • AWS (EC2, EKS, RDS, S3, among others)

 

Requirements:

  • 5+ years combined experience of software development experience in both SRE and full-stack roles
  • Experience using container technologies to test locally or deployment in production environments
  • Experience with Terraform and container technologies is essential
  • Ability to articulate and make decisions about trade-offs between rapid iteration and high-quality products
  • Self-motivated and able to work independently in an efficient manner
  • Dislike solving the same problems again and again - so you automate or eliminate them
  • Are inspired to improving workflows to make everyone’s jobs easier
  • Like to collaborate with others to solve problems, share knowledge, and provide feedback
  • Strong communication skills when discussing technical concepts with technical and non-technical colleagues

 

Preferred skills:

  • Experience or interest in using Rust
  • Experience with live video streaming best practices and protocols
  • Experience deploying services with low latency requirements in a containerized environment

Role Type: Full Time

Location: Remote



Company Information

OSI Engineering is a leading talent acquisition and services company, building powerful IT and Engineering development teams to meet speed-to-market demands across the US. We develop, implement and manage workforce solutions through every stage of the product lifecycle, from early application development through final production, delivering the highest-level technology professionals. Our capabilities include technical staff augmentation, managed service programs and resource planning solutions.

With over 20 years of experience, OSI’s technical expertise spans the software stack from the firmware layer up to the user interface. We deliver dynamic and diverse teams for IT Services, Networking Data Services, Cloud Infrastructure and Services, Big Data, Mobile Hardware and Applications, Internet of Things (IoT), Connected Car, Enterprise Information Security and Data Science. Our quality-focused approach to talent acquisition and services helps our clients successfully launch their concepts and products that change the world.

Dice Id : 10365912
Position Id : 6941653
Originally Posted : 3 months ago

Similar Positions at OSI Engineering, Inc.